I have been privileged to be in DUMC since 1999. It is a blessing to see the church grow, its passion for mission and also keeping up with technology. DUMC is one of the earliest churches in Malaysia to go online live. This has certainly been a blessing  to me since I used to work outstation. This has also allowed me to serve in the writing ministry for many years. There are moments where I have written the sermon summary while I was in Penang, Melaka, Johor and even once in Vietnam. 

Having our church on a digital platform allows me to just send links to my friends. During one of the weekends. DUMC had invited Mr. Mun Toh to preach.  He preached a beautiful message on caring for our parents and the Golden Club and the senior community at large. Mun Toh happened to be my comedy mentor. It is because of him that I am in comedy. DUMC being digital allowed me to just copy and send the link to all my comedy friends in KL, Christians and non-Christians alike. All my friends were able to watch him preach in the comfort of their own homes. It allowed me to also introduce the church in a very simple manner. 

During the pandemic SIBKL started a prayer session on Zoom where there was continuous prayer for about 2 months. It was beautiful seeing all tribes and tongues come together to worship and pray. When I log online, I can feel the power of the Holy Spirit. 

Elder Wan Kuan was the organiser of probably the biggest Orang Asli gathering in Bentong. Every indigenous tribe in Malaysia was there. Every part of this conference was nothing short of a miracle, from getting the approval to gathering all the tribes together in one venue. There were close to 500 people in that hall. I was only an usher standing outside and welcoming the guests when they arrived and left. It was my burning bush experience. The presence of God was so strong I felt unworthy but privileged to be there. Since then, there hasn’t been a conference where I have attended that impacted me so much.
